SHRI KUMARASWAY DIXITAR AND LORD SHRI RAJA GANAPTHI AT NEW JERSEY

Shri Dixitar had his training under Tiruchi Swamigal. He was the cheif priest at Gavi puram Gangadareshwar temple near Bangalore, Karnataka. For generations Dixitar family have been official priests for the Gavi Puram temple.

Sri Dixitar came to USA in 1984 initially to Flint and then later joined the Albany Hindu Temple. He was the chief Priest at the Albany Temple from 1984 till 2004. Sri Dixitar has also participated in the capacity of a Director/Chief Priest in Shilpa Sthapanams of many Hindu Temples in USA and Canada.

Spiritual and Veda Agama Sudha a non-profit organization was found by Shri Shivaguru Kumaraswamy Dixitar in 1994 at Albany, NY with a vision and mission to promote and sustain Vedic Dharma and the practice of Sanathana Dharma. He has established  a Veda Agama Sudha Ashram- SIVAGURU ASHRAM at Swedesboro, New Jersey, in the year 2004,  to meet  the needs of an individual going through all of four stages of life. His plans include building a Sri Raja Ganapathi Temple at Swedesboro, New Jersey.
